Floyd Mayweather and Beyonce are two of the most accomplished personalities in their respective fields. Notably, the two seemingly also have a great relationship as Money once came to the pop star’s defense after her controversial performance at the Super Bowl back in 2016.

In an interview with FightHype TV, the former five-division world champion discussed her halftime performance, which drew criticism for being too politically motivated and ‘anti-police’. Mayweather came to her defense and stated that she was a great performer and another entertainer would not have been criticized in this manner. “I think Beyonce, I think she’s a queen, she’s a drop-dead gorgeous woman, she’s a remarkable dancer, and she’s at the pinnacle. If it was anyone else, they wouldn’t have nothing to say,” he told the reporter.

Further, he also claimed that he would never criticize her and also wished that his daughters could someday be like her.” I would never criticize Beyonce. I keep my fingers crossed that someday my daughters can be the next Beyonce you know,” he said.

He then praised her claiming that she would go down as a ‘legend’ in music and that she worked harder than any other female musician. “Very powerful woman, very gorgeous woman, strong woman, not a good entertainer, a great entertainer, and she’s going down as a legend. I’m never going to say anything about a woman that works harder than any other female in the music business. I will never do that. Absolutely not,” he added.

There has been a lot of speculation regarding a potential rematch between Conor McGregor and Floyd Mayweather. A report from The Sun suggested that there have been talks between the two camps and the deal is very close to being finalized. It was also reported that this would be a professional bout with Mayweather’s record on the line.

via Getty

The two first faced off back in 2017, with Mayweather getting the victory via knockout in the tenth round. This bout also marked the last professional fight of Money’s illustrious career. However, we might get to see him make one last heist against the Irishman.
